SWIFT ACTION BY POLICE LEAD TO ARREST OF ARMED ROBBERY SUSPECT

Nassau, Bahamas - According to reports, sometime around 7:30pm on Tuesday 9 September 2014, police were called to the Lightbourne Avenue in the Farrington Road area, where they saw two males who reported that while walking they were accosted by two males armed with handguns and cloth ties over their faces, who robbed them of their cash, jewelry and cell phone. Shortly after the incident, police acting on information from members of the public went into the Rock Cusher area where they arrested a 19yr old male.

POLICE INVESTIGATE OVERNIGHT DAMAGE REPORT

According to reports, sometime around 12:30am officers responded to reports of gunshots in the Lightbourne Street area of Yellow Elder Gardens. Upon their arrival on the scene they spoke to a 35yr old male, who reported that person’s unknown drove through the corner and fired several gunshots into his Honda vehicle causing significant damage before speeding off.
